KINGS of PARTHIA. Vologases IV. Circa AD 147-191. BI Tetradrachm (25mm, 12.49 g, 12h). Seleukeia on the Tigris mint. Dated SE 494 (AD 181/2). Diademed bust left, wearing tiara; B to right / Vologases seated left, receiving wreath from Tyche standing right, holding scepter; year above. Cf. Sellwood 84.92-5 (for type); Sunrise –; Shore –. Toned, porosity. Good VF.

From the MWF Collection. Ex Russell Bement, Jr. Collection (Classical Numismatic Group 51, 15 September 1999), lot 641.
